Why Data Analyst Careers Are Growing Faster Across Industries in 2026

Businesses across the world are entering a new phase where data has become one of the most valuable resources for growth and innovation. Companies are collecting information from customers, digital platforms, operational systems, and connected devices, creating a strong demand for professionals who can analyze and interpret this information. The career path of a Data Analyst in 2026 is gaining significant attention because organizations need skilled experts who can turn raw data into meaningful insights and support smarter decision making.


The rapid adoption of artificial intelligence, cloud computing, automation, and advanced analytics has changed how companies operate. Data analysis is no longer limited to technology departments. Marketing teams, financial institutions, healthcare providers, retail businesses, and manufacturing companies are all depending on analytics professionals to improve efficiency and identify new opportunities.


Becoming a successful analyst in this changing environment requires technical knowledge, industry awareness, and the ability to communicate insights effectively. Professionals who develop these capabilities can access a wide range of career opportunities in 2026 and beyond.



The Expanding Role of Data Analysts in Modern Businesses


The responsibilities of analysts have evolved significantly over the years. Earlier, many organizations used data mainly for reporting past performance. Today, businesses use analytics to predict future trends, understand customer behavior, and make proactive decisions.


A Data Analyst in 2026 is expected to do more than create reports. These professionals collect information, clean datasets, identify patterns, build dashboards, and provide recommendations that influence business strategies.


Companies are using analytics to answer important questions such as why customers choose specific products, which marketing campaigns deliver better results, and how operational processes can be improved. Analysts help organizations discover these answers through accurate data interpretation.


As businesses continue their digital transformation journeys, the role of analysts is becoming increasingly important across different sectors.



Why Companies Across Industries Need Data Analysts


The demand for analytics professionals is increasing because every industry generates large volumes of information. However, data only creates value when organizations can understand and use it effectively.


In the healthcare sector, analysts help improve patient services, manage healthcare information, and identify trends that support better outcomes. Financial organizations use analytics to evaluate risks, monitor transactions, and improve customer experiences.


Retail companies rely on analysts to understand buying patterns, optimize inventory, and personalize customer interactions. Manufacturing organizations use data analysis to improve production efficiency, reduce waste, and maintain quality standards.


Technology companies also require analytics professionals to measure product performance, understand user behavior, and support innovation. This widespread adoption of data driven strategies is creating more career opportunities for aspiring analysts.



Essential Skills Driving Data Analyst Career Growth


The increasing importance of analytics has also changed the skill requirements for professionals. Employers now look for candidates who can combine technical expertise with business knowledge.


SQL continues to be one of the most important skills because databases store large amounts of organizational information. Analysts use SQL to access, organize, and manage data efficiently.


Programming knowledge, especially Python, has become highly valuable. Python enables analysts to automate processes, perform advanced analysis, and work with large datasets. Understanding Python libraries for data processing and visualization can improve career opportunities.


Data visualization is another critical skill. Tools such as Power BI and Tableau help analysts present complex information through interactive dashboards and reports. Clear visualization allows business leaders to quickly understand important trends.


Along with technical skills, communication and problem solving abilities help analysts explain insights and support strategic decisions.



The Influence of Artificial Intelligence on Data Analytics Careers


Artificial intelligence is one of the biggest factors shaping analytics careers in 2026. AI technologies are helping professionals analyze information faster, automate repetitive tasks, and discover patterns that may not be easily visible.


A modern Data Analyst in 2026 should understand how AI can support data preparation, reporting, and predictive analysis. AI powered platforms are becoming common in business environments, making AI knowledge a valuable addition to traditional analytics skills.


However, human expertise remains essential. Analysts need critical thinking abilities to verify results, understand business challenges, and provide recommendations based on accurate interpretation.


The combination of human analytical skills and AI capabilities is creating new possibilities for professionals who want to build future ready careers.



Building Career Opportunities Through Practical Experience


Employers often value practical experience because it demonstrates a candidate’s ability to apply knowledge in real situations. Beginners should focus on developing projects that reflect common business challenges.


Examples include analyzing customer trends, creating financial dashboards, studying marketing performance, and evaluating operational efficiency. These projects help candidates improve their analytical thinking and create a strong professional portfolio.


Internships, freelance projects, and collaborative assignments can also provide valuable experience. Working with real datasets helps individuals understand the challenges involved in data cleaning, analysis, and reporting.


Continuous practice is essential because analytics skills improve through regular application.



Future Career Paths for Data Analytics Professionals


The growth of data driven decision making has created multiple career opportunities. Entry level professionals can begin their journey as Junior Data Analysts, Reporting Analysts, or Business Intelligence Associates.


With experience, analysts can progress into roles such as Senior Data Analyst, Analytics Consultant, Product Analyst, Data Strategy Manager, or Business Intelligence Lead.


Some professionals also specialize in specific areas such as marketing analytics, financial analytics, healthcare analytics, or customer intelligence. These specialized paths allow individuals to combine industry knowledge with analytical expertise.


The future of analytics careers will continue expanding as organizations search for professionals who can create value from information.



Preparing for a Successful Analytics Future


A successful career in analytics requires continuous improvement and adaptability. Professionals must stay updated with emerging technologies, industry trends, and changing business requirements.


Learning new tools, earning relevant certifications, participating in analytics communities, and building practical projects can strengthen career growth.


The most successful analysts will be those who combine technical capabilities with curiosity, creativity, and the ability to solve complex business problems.
